Put cat back on and ahhhhh, i like it.

Maybe I'm getting old or something but today I replaced my cat bypass with the old cat and ahhh, I like the quieter sound (plus less stinky clothes). I have a modified stock exhaust with a dual outlet on the passenger side. Sounds mellower and not as drony or raspy (with the bypass) but still is quite a bit louder than totally stock.

The main reason I put the cat back on is to reduce the smoke from my bad valve guides. I put in a SW chip last week and that really stepped up the smoke at idle. Now it's not nearly as bad and the reduced power isn't all that noticeable. The SW chip makes great smooth power and I didn't realize how loud my car was with the bypass. I'll get the topend redone next spring and probably put the bypass back on then.

But for now, sometimes there's more to a nice drive than pure power.

Now that I've swapped it out a couple times.... I can see myself putting the bypass back on for track days and save the cat for daily duty. It's pretty simple to do... 9 bolts and an O2 sensor. Took a little over an hour today for the whole thing.
